这用到的是tableExport.jquery.plugin
这个库,这是官方github,这是它的npm库的介绍,上面都有说明和用法
重点
这个导出的格式是.xls
如果想导出格式为.xlsx
,就是这里,点吧
今天简单说一下,将页面上的table导出为excel,如下图:
代码也超级简单,只用到两个js文件,都在我给的官方地址可以找到,导出的配置也在:
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Document</title>
<script src="./js/jquery-1.10.2.min.js"></script>
<script src="./js/tableExport.min.js"></script>
</head>
<body>
<button onClick ="$('#tableData').tableExport({ type: 'excel', escape: 'false', fileName: '哈哈哈哈'})">导出excel</button>
<table border="2" id="tableData">
<tr>
<td>不发给他</td>
<td>豆腐乳</td>
<td>古田会议他</td>
<td>官方灯管合同</td>
</tr>
<tr>
<td>VG环保厅内</td>
<td>从大V粉带吧</td>
<td>跟团游假如有</td>
<td>从大V粉带吧</td>
</tr>
<tr>
<td>从大V粉带吧</td>
<td>歌剧院</td>
<td>不阖家团圆</td>
<td>还能</td>
</tr>
<tr>
<td>从大V粉带吧</td>
<td>你核桃仁母乳</td>
<td>从大V粉带吧</td>
<td>被害人你就有人</td>
</tr>
<tr>
<td>从大V粉带吧</td>
<td>从大V粉带吧</td>
<td>从大V粉带吧</td>
<td>从大V粉带吧</td>
</tr>
</table>
</body>
</html>
当然它的用法不止于此,他也可以用到vue
上,有npm库
,导出形式也不止excel这一种,有下图这么多种,每种的用法依赖都不一样,都有说明:
就酱~